Optimizing the Core: Confronting Environmental Hurdles in Pigment production
the center with the environmental obstacle inside the pigment business lies within the production approach alone. customarily, the synthesis of complicated organic pigments has become an energy-intense and chemically demanding endeavor. A Principal concern may be the considerable use of natural solvents, that happen to be frequently necessary to facilitate chemical reactions and accomplish the specified crystal construction of your pigment. Many of those conventional solvents are risky natural compounds (VOCs), which could escape into your ambiance in the course of generation, heating, and drying stages. VOCs are A serious contributor to air air pollution, bringing about the development of ground-amount ozone and posing well being hazards to industrial staff and nearby communities. Furthermore, the synthesis of significant-general performance pigments frequently necessitates reactions at large temperatures and pressures, followed by Electricity-intensive drying and milling procedures. This superior Electricity intake interprets on to a considerable carbon footprint, positioning a heavy load on our Earth's climate.
In reaction, the field is going through a profound transformation towards greener production protocols. foremost suppliers are actively phasing out hazardous solvents in favor of green options, like ionic liquids or supercritical fluids, which have a A lot lower environmental influence. where by conventional solvents remain required, the implementation Wholesale Perylene Pigment of advanced shut-loop recovery devices has become regular follow. These techniques seize and condense solvent vapors, enabling them to get purified and reused, significantly lowering VOC emissions and operational prices. around the Power entrance, innovation is centered on procedure optimization and warmth recovery. contemporary reactors are made for superior thermal effectiveness, and reducing-edge heat exchangers are now being put in to seize waste warmth from substantial-temperature processes and redirect it to other plant functions, like pre-heating Uncooked components or drying concluded products. These strategic optimizations aren't just about compliance; they depict a elementary change toward lean, effective, and lower-affect manufacturing.
The Three-Pronged squander issue: controlling Effluents, Emissions, and strong Residues
Beyond the core manufacturing system, the management of squander streams—liquid, gaseous, and reliable—presents A further substantial hurdle. Pigment manufacturing invariably generates advanced wastewater characterized by significant shade depth, chemical oxygen desire (COD), and often high salinity. Discharging this effluent without intensive treatment would cause serious ecological harm to aquatic ecosystems. Gaseous emissions are Yet another problem; outside of VOCs, particular chemical reactions can release nitrogen oxides (NOx), sulfur oxides (SOx), or malodorous compounds that add to acid rain and air quality degradation. ultimately, the method generates solid waste, which includes expended filter media, residual sludge from wastewater treatment, and off-spec product. Disposing of the strong squander in landfills is don't just unsustainable but in addition signifies a loss of possible sources.
To deal with this tripartite obstacle, a comprehensive and built-in approach to squander administration is crucial. A point out-of-the-artwork perylene pigment factory now operates extra similar to a useful resource reclamation facility than a conventional chemical plant. Wastewater undergoes a multi-stage cure course of action that commences with Bodily and chemical pre-procedure to eliminate coloration and suspended solids. This is commonly followed by advanced Organic cure, such as membrane bioreactors (MBR), which use microorganisms to break down complicated natural compounds. For specially stubborn pollutants, Innovative Oxidation Processes (AOPs) are deployed as a last sharpening step to ensure the h2o is Risk-free for discharge. For air emissions, regenerative thermal oxidizers (RTOs) are used to demolish hazardous gases at higher performance. most of all, the business is embracing a circular overall economy state of mind for stable waste. in lieu of currently being landfilled, products like filter cake and particular forms of sludge are analyzed for their possible reuse. Some are repurposed as inert fillers in construction resources like bricks or cement, turning a waste liability right into a valuable secondary raw product and closing the loop on a the moment-linear course of action.
The product or service as the answer: Elevating Eco-general performance and Regulatory Compliance
The force for sustainability extends much over and above the factory gates and to the incredibly DNA in the pigment by itself. in the present global industry, governed by stringent regulations like Europe's arrive at (Registration, analysis, Authorisation and Restriction of chemical compounds) and RoHS (Restriction of harmful Substances), a pigment is judged not only on its shade but on its environmental and health profile. The focus has shifted to generating pigments with very low toxicity, small significant metal content, and reduced migration features, ensuring They are really Harmless to be used in sensitive purposes like toys (EN-71 typical), foods packaging, and buyer electronics.
This is when higher-performance pigments, which include Those people during the perylene pigment spouse and children, really glow being a sustainable Remedy. Products like Perylene Black 32 are engineered for Fantastic sturdiness. Their fantastic mild fastness suggests they resist fading even below extended publicity to sunlight. Their significant thermal security lets them to resist the intense temperatures of plastic extrusion and higher-bake automotive coatings devoid of degradation. This amazing resilience is a strong kind of oblique environmentalism. When a coating, plastic, or fiber retains its shade and integrity for for a longer period, the lifespan of the top-product or service is prolonged. This cuts down the necessity for substitution, which consequently conserves the raw supplies, Power, and h2o that might are actually eaten in production a different merchandise. By designing for longevity, pigment suppliers lead straight to lessening usage and waste generation throughout numerous downstream industries.

another Frontier: Innovation and R&D as the Engine for Eco-Breakthroughs
when present-day technologies have made immense strides, the lengthy-term vision for A very sustainable pigment field is remaining forged in investigate and growth labs. the following wave of innovation aims to essentially redesign pigment synthesis from the ground up, shifting faraway from a reliance on fossil fuels and harsh chemical procedures. scientists are Discovering novel artificial pathways that leverage biotechnology, which include utilizing enzymes as catalysts (biocatalysis) to carry out reactions at lower temperatures and with greater specificity, thus cutting down Strength use and by-product or service formation.
Another critical area of R&D is the development of pigments from renewable, non-petroleum-based feedstocks. This bio-based strategy seeks to decouple pigment output within the risky and environmentally taxing petrochemical sector. In addition, as industries like coatings and printing inks keep on to shift away from solvent-based units, there is enormous deal with producing pigments and dispersion systems optimized for waterborne techniques. developing secure, high-efficiency aqueous dispersions of pigments like Perylene Black is actually a important R&D target, mainly because it right permits the formulation of eco-helpful, low-VOC paints, inks, and coatings that should outline the marketplace of the longer term. This relentless pursuit of innovation makes certain that the industry is not simply reacting to present rules but actively shaping a more sustainable tomorrow.
